Setup

Ivy installer is used to create new application boilerplate and setup the project in no time!

Usage

In your command line, write:

npm install -g ivy-cli 

for npm, or

yarn global add ivy-cli

for yarn, in order to setup the ivy installer.

After that ivy command is going to be available globaly.

To create a new project, just run:

ivy new ${project name}

for example ivy new blog, and a new folder named "blog", which includes the application boilerplate is going to be created.
